About Mocha
Mocha is a young, loving mom settling in to the comfort of indoor life, having started off as a community cat before arriving at the shelter in Austin, TX. She quickly picked up on all the perks—soft naps in windows, gentle company, and constant affection. Mocha is deeply affectionate, loves to be held, and prefers sharing sweet little chirps over loud meows. Toys are still a new concept for her, but curiosity leads her to try a bit more each day. She’s fully litter box trained and has taken to being an indoor cat with ease. Visitors find her friendly, and she’s done well with a calm resident cat in her foster home. Mocha might be happiest with another laid-back cat rather than one who’s full of energy. She hasn’t met dogs yet.
